I need some help please :)

I am new to Zenworks and how it works. I am using LDAP for DIR
serivces in a Websense filtering environment. The users manual
authentication is failing. I have a situation where the user is found
with his attributes in other containers. We found a few problems,
including DNS, and configuration issues. When the authentication
problem persisted, we were able to diagnose that there were multiple
objects in LDAP with the same ID. We are aware that we need unique
users, and had cleaned up duplicates months ago. I used dstrace and A
search revealed unknown objects in LDAP with the same name as his
login. When we deleted them, things worked as expected. We now
believe that there is a program that is designed to create workstation
objects, with unique names based on the workstation name. This is to
identify workstations assigned IPs by DHCP. Instead, it is creating
unknown objects in various containers. ConsoleOne displays these
objects with a question mark (?). The LDAP administrator will clean
these objects out, and will work on determining how to avoid having
this happen again. A program called Zenworks is the current suspect.

Can Zenworks create user attributes in more than one container?.
If so how can I make it stop?
